WHILE The Force Awakens for Star Wars fans across the globe this Christmas, some children may be in for a stocking full of dangerous counterfeit action figures.
Cashing in on the popularity of major movie franchises, dodgy retailers are flogging cheap rubbish to unsuspecting parents with no regard to safety standards.
In a single afternoon browsing Melbourne’s discount stores news.com.au found them awash with knock off Star Wars, Lego, Avengers, Minecraft, Superman, Pokemon, Nintendo, and Disney products.
